Apr 14, 2019· In 2007 all gold production in New Mexico (13,000 troy ounces (400 kg)) came as a byproduct of copper mining from two large open pit mines in Grant County. However, two primary gold mines are being readied for production: the Northstar mine in Rio Arriba County, and the San Lorenzo Claims mine in Socorro County. North Carolina

About 244,000 metric tons of gold has been discovered to date (187,000 metric tons historically produced plus current underground reserves of 57,000 metric tons). Most of that gold has come from just three countries: China, Australia, and South Africa. Oct 15, 2019· How Much Gold Has Been Mined? No one knows for certain how to calculate the total amount of gold ever mined, but the best guess is that around 190,040 tonnes of gold have been mined throughout history, reports the World Gold Council (WGC). Each year, mining operations extract about 2,500 to 3,000 tonnes of gold.

Apr 09, 2020· Fairview Mine produces almost half of the gold mined at the Barberton Mines complex. Barberton Mines' have current Mineral Reserves of 1.4 Moz., producing gold at 5.65 g/t, with an annual capacity up to 80 000 oz./annum and a life-of-mine of 20 years for the current known Mineral Resources.

Mar 31, 2011· The head frame of the Tau Tona Mine is the lone entrance to over 500 miles of tunnels. Located in South Africa, the Witwatersrand Basin represents the richest gold field ever discovered. It is estimated the 40% of all of the gold ever mined has come out of the Basin.

How is gold mined?

In placer mining, the gold is retrieved by metal detecting, panning, cradling, sluicing and dredging. Using gravity and water to separate the dense gold from the other materials that surround it, this is the most common gold mining category for amateur gold hunters. It is estimated that gold has been mined since 18,000 Be. Gold is the most malleable metal, it can be hammered into foil 3/1,000,000 of an inch thick. The Lihir gold mine in Papua New Guinea dumps over 5 million tons of toxic waste into the Pacific Ocean each year, destroying corals and other ocean life. Gold, recognizable by its yellowish cast, is one of the oldest metals used by humans. As far back as the Neolithic period, humans have collected gold from stream beds, and the actual mining of gold can be traced as far back as 3500 B.C., when early Egyptians (the Sumerian culture of Mesopotamia) used mined gold to craft elaborate jewelry, religious artifacts, and utensils such as goblets.

How much gold has been mined? The best estimates currently available suggest that around 197,576 tonnes of gold has been mined throughout history, of which around two-thirds has been mined since 1950. And since gold is virtually indestructible, this means that almost all of this metal is still around in one form or another.
